Title :
Calculation of transient wave fields in layered bodies
Author :
Kühnicke, Elfgard
Author_Institution :
Inst. of Tech. Acoust., Tech. Univ. Dresden, Germany
Abstract :
For ultrasonic problems, an optimized approximation method was developed to calculate the transducer generated sound field in layered media with curved interfaces. The transient sound field is calculated for two-layered problems such as angle beam probes coupled to a half-space, and sound fields in steel after a water delay. It is demonstrated that Snell´s law is not applicable to calculate the incidence angle of the sound field generated by a limited element
